That's a Very early Steens " Burritto" . It's was made b/4 the Taco22 . Notice the bolt together frame .The upper frame was modular so it could be used for other models like the Tacquito and the "55" .Also notice the small tubes on the upper frame, They would have been either the engine mount for the Tacquitto or a swing arm mount for the "55". Those rims would have been correct as well .They are the early Tri-Stars B/4 Taco's had thier own style of rim . This is a Very Cool Find !:thumbsup:
